    Lose Body Fat Quickly: Myth or Fact?



    Although it is possible to lose body fat quickly, there are some people who might have to work much harder than others to lose body fat quickly.

    This is because each individual has a different set of circumstances, a different metabolism, and different genetic factors that come into play.

    Although everyone is unique, there still is a basic formula that can be used to determine how soon one can transform one's body…

    In order to know how to lose body fat quickly, the first thing you need to calculate is how long it takes to burn a pound of fat. Every pound of stored body fat has 3,500 calories. Since your target calorie reduction should be somewhere between 300 and 700 calories a day below your caloric maintenance level, you can expect to burn half a pound to two pounds of fat each week.

    While the specific amount of fat you lose each week will depend on many things, losing ½ a pound to two pounds a week is really the safest way to lose body fat quickly and keep it off over the long-term.

    When you try to lose more than this, you might trigger your body's famine response, which makes the body protect its fat stores by slowing down its metabolism. If you want to lose body fat quickly, it is best to not go overboard by trying to lose more than half a pound to two pounds per week; by exceeding the recommended amount, you are reducing your body's ability to lose fat and keep it off.

    You need to remember that even though you want to lose body fat quickly, it's critical to maintain a certain percentage of fat in your body to stay healthy. As a general rule, the following levels, based on the most recent statistics, should be followed when you want to lose body fat quickly.

    ***Male
    Aged up to 30 = 9%–15%
    Aged 30–50 = 11%–17%
    Aged 50+ = 12%–19%

    ***Female
    Aged up to 30 = 14%–21%
    Aged 30–50 = 15%–23%
    Aged 50+ = 16%–25%

    The percentage of body fat tends to increase with age due to the inability to maintain lean muscle mass. To stay in optimal health, men should maintain a body fat percentage of 8%–14% and women should work towards maintaining 13%–20% body fat. If you let your body fat levels drop under the recommended percentage for an extended period of time, you're setting yourself up for health problems.

    As long as you stay within that healthy target range, how low you go is a personal preference that depends on how you want your body to look.
